A severe winter storm is currently affecting travel and infrastructure in northern states.

A severe winter storm is impacting the northern United States, particularly in states like Montana, North Dakota, and Maine. The storm commenced early this morning, bringing heavy snowfall and strong winds. These conditions have resulted in dangerous travel scenarios and multiple road closures.
According to the National Weather Service, snowfall has already surpassed 12 inches in some regions.

As the storm progresses, thousands are experiencing power outages due to fallen trees and damaged power lines. Utility companies are actively working to restore electricity.
However, officials caution that some areas may remain without power for an extended duration.
Travel warnings issued
State officials have issued travel warnings, advising residents to avoid non-essential travel until conditions improve. Airports are also facing delays and cancellations, complicating travel for many individuals.
